The third disadvantage for conventional gear is that they cannot utilize all of the theoretically available braking friction on dry pavement, because braking force is limited by forward pitching moment, so landings and aborted takeoffs rely more on aerodynamic drag like flaps and high angle of attack and elevator down force to resist brake pitching force. Tandem arrangements are characterised by the main and auxiliary gear being aligned on the same longitudinal axis, usually with a number of smaller supporting outrigger gears to support the aircraft while on the ground. The power pack is a small contained system that incorporates an electric pump to provide hydraulic pressure, a reservoir to house the hydraulic fluid, and a set of valves and hydraulic lines to transfer the fluid to and from a set of double-action actuators responsible for lowering and raising the gear.
